Who lost money in the Boston Tea Party. 340 chests of British East India Company Tea weighing over 92000 pounds roughly 46 tons onboard the Beaver Dartmouth and Eleanor were smashed open by the Sons of Liberty armed with an assortment of axes and dumped into Boston Harbor the night of December 16 1773.

On this day in 1774 British Parliament passes the Boston Port Act closing the port of Boston and demanding that the citys residents pay for the nearly 1 million worth in todays money of tea dumped into Boston Harbor during the Boston Tea Party of December 16 1773.

The Sugar Act of 1764 was a law enacted by Britain to increase British revenues by preventing the smuggling of molasses into the American colonies and enforcing the collection of higher taxes. The property damage amounted to the destruction of 92000 pounds or 340 chests of tea reported by the British East India Company worth 9659 or 1700000 dollars in todays money.

The Boston Tea Party was an American political and mercantile protest by the Sons of Liberty in Boston Massachusetts on December 16 1773.
